Soffit Board Materials: Comparing Vinyl, Aluminum, and Wood
Selecting soffit panel substance involves understanding crucial contrasts in vinyl , aluminum , and lumber. Vinyl soffit is typically one generally affordable option , giving adequate climate resistance and minimal maintenance . Aluminum fascia provides enhanced resilience and heat safety, whereas being somewhat easy to installation . Nevertheless , aluminum may be increasingly expensive . Common Soffit Board Problems and How to Fix Them
Many homes experience troubles with their soffit sections over time . A common issue is rot caused by dampness . This often develops where the soffit joins the fascia. Symptoms include soft wood, staining , and even cracks. Another problem is animal infestation, particularly from insects seeking refuge . To repair rot, affected sections need to be removed and replaced with new, sealed lumber. For insect problems, a thorough cleaning and caulking of entry points is necessary , and sometimes professional pest control services are required . Regular inspection and care are vital to prevent future issues.
